インターネット

SMTPSとは?セキュアなメール送信プロトコルの概要

SMTPS(Simple Mail Transfer Protocol Secure)は、電子メールの送信時にセキュリティを強化するプロトコルです。

SMTPにSSL/TLS暗号化を組み合わせることで、メールデータの送受信時に内容の盗聴や改ざんを防ぎます。

これにより、認証情報や本文が安全に伝送され、信頼性の高いメールコミュニケーションが実現されます。

SMTPSはポート465を使用し、特に機密情報を扱う場面で広く利用されています。

SMTPSの概要

SMTPS(Simple Mail Transfer Protocol Secure)は、電子メールの送信に使用されるSMTPプロトコルにセキュリティ機能を追加した拡張プロトコルです。

SMTPは、電子メールを送信するための標準的なプロトコルですが、デフォルトでは通信が暗号化されていないため、送信中の情報が傍受されるリスクがあります。

SMTPSは、TLS(Transport Layer Security)またはSSL(Secure Sockets Layer)を利用して通信を暗号化し、データの機密性と整合性を確保します。

これにより、第三者による情報の盗聴や改ざんを防ぎ、安全なメール送信が可能になります。

SMTPSとSMTPの違い

特徴SMTPSMTPS
通信の暗号化なしTLSまたはSSLによる暗号化
使用ポート25番、もしくはSTARTTLSで587番465番
セキュリティ通信が平文で行われるため安全性が低い通信が暗号化されるため高い安全性を提供
認証方式通常のユーザー名とパスワード認証サーバー証明書による認証が追加される場合が多い
導入の複雑さ比較的簡単証明書の取得と設定が必要でやや複雑

この表から分かるように、SMTPSはSMTPに比べて通信の安全性が大幅に向上しており、特に機密性の高い情報を扱う際に有効です。

SMTPSのセキュリティ機能

SMTPSが提供する主なセキュリティ機能は以下の通りです:

  1. 通信の暗号化
  • TLS/SSLプロトコルを使用して、送信されるメールデータを暗号化します。これにより、データが中間で傍受されても内容を解読されることが防止されます。
  1. サーバー認証
  • サーバー証明書を用いて、通信相手のサーバーが信頼できるものであることを確認します。これにより、中間者攻撃(MitM)を防止します。
  1. データの整合性
  • 送信中にデータが改ざんされていないことを保証します。これにより、メール内容が送信後に変更されるリスクを低減します。
  1. クライアント認証(オプション)
  • 一部の設定では、クライアントも証明書によって認証されることがあります。これにより、送信者の正当性がさらに強化されます。

これらの機能により、SMTPSはメール送信時のセキュリティを高いレベルで確保します。

SMTPSの導入方法

SMTPSを導入するための基本的な手順は以下の通りです:

  1. メールサーバーソフトウェアの選定
  • SMTPをサポートするメールサーバーソフトウェア(例:Postfix、Exim、Microsoft Exchange)を選びます。
  1. SSL/TLS証明書の取得
  • 信頼できる認証局(CA)からSSL/TLS証明書を取得します。無料の証明書としてはLet’s Encryptがあります。
  1. 証明書のインストール
  • 取得した証明書をメールサーバーにインストールし、適切なディレクトリに配置します。
  1. メールサーバーの設定
  • メールサーバーの設定ファイルを編集し、TLS/SSLを有効にします。具体的には、次の項目を設定します:
  • 使用する証明書ファイルと秘密鍵のパス
  • 使用するTLSバージョンや暗号スイートの指定
  1. ポートの設定
  • SMTPS専用のポート(通常は465番)を開放し、メールサーバーがこのポートでの接続を受け付けるように設定します。
  1. ファイアウォールの設定
  • サーバーのファイアウォールで、SMTPS専用ポートへのアクセスを許可します。
  1. 動作確認
  • 設定が正しく動作しているかを確認します。メールクライアントを使用して、SMTPS経由でメールを送信し、暗号化が有効になっていることを確認します。
  1. クライアント設定の更新
  • 組織内のメールクライアントに対して、送信サーバーの設定をSMTPSに対応するよう更新します。具体的には、送信ポートを465番に変更し、SSL/TLSを有効にします。

これらの手順を丁寧に実行することで、SMTPSを安全かつ効果的に導入することができます。

まとめ

この記事では、SMTPSの基本的な概念からそのセキュリティ機能、導入手順までを詳しく解説しました。

SMTPSを活用することで、メールの送信過程における安全性が大幅に向上し、重要な情報を守ることができます。

安心してメールを利用するために、ぜひSMTPSの導入をご検討ください。

関連記事

Back to top button